“ode to bany’s blog post on a squirrel”
a solitary squirrel
huddled,
in nature’s warm embrace
a whithered oak
outside,
rage bitter winds
snow gently blankets
the hard ground
a primal impetus
to survive
to live another season
yes we shall
– Zachary Uram (c) 2011
